DeepSeek系列:解码AI搜索新势力,从原理到应用全解析
2025.09.25 16:01浏览量:0简介:本文深入解析DeepSeek系列技术,从其核心架构与算法创新出发,详细阐述其在智能搜索、数据分析、自然语言处理等领域的多维度应用场景,并提供技术选型与开发实践建议。
一、DeepSeek技术架构解析:从搜索到智能的进化
DeepSeek并非单一产品,而是一个基于深度学习与自然语言处理技术构建的智能搜索与分析平台。其核心架构由三大模块组成:多模态语义理解引擎、动态知识图谱与自适应推理系统。
1.1 多模态语义理解引擎
传统搜索引擎依赖关键词匹配,而DeepSeek通过BERT、GPT等预训练模型的变体,实现了对文本、图像、音频的跨模态语义关联。例如,用户上传一张产品图片,系统可自动解析其功能特性,并关联相关技术文档与用户评价。
技术实现:
# 伪代码示例:基于CLIP模型的跨模态检索
from transformers import CLIPModel, CLIPProcessor
model = CLIPModel.from_pretrained("openai/clip-vit-base-patch32")
processor = CLIPProcessor.from_pretrained("openai/clip-vit-base-patch32")
def cross_modal_search(image_path, text_query):
# 图像特征提取
image_features = model.get_image_features(processor(images=[image_path], return_tensors="pt")["pixel_values"])
# 文本特征提取
text_features = model.get_text_features(processor(text=[text_query], return_tensors="pt")["input_ids"])
# 计算相似度
similarity = (image_features @ text_features.T).softmax(dim=-1)
return similarity.argmax().item()
1.2 动态知识图谱
区别于静态知识库,DeepSeek的知识图谱通过实时爬取权威数据源(如学术论文、专利数据库)与用户行为反馈,实现图谱结构的动态更新。例如,在技术选型场景中,系统可基于项目需求自动推荐最优框架组合,并标注各框架的兼容性风险。
1.3 自适应推理系统
针对不同行业场景,DeepSeek提供可配置的推理策略。医疗领域强调合规性,系统会优先调用经过FDA认证的算法模型;而金融领域则侧重实时性,采用轻量化模型与边缘计算结合的方案。
二、DeepSeek的核心能力:重构信息处理范式
2.1 智能搜索的范式升级
- 语义搜索:突破关键词限制,理解”如何用Python实现分布式锁”等复杂查询的深层意图。
- 上下文感知:在多轮对话中保持上下文连贯性,例如技术咨询场景中自动关联前序问题。
- 多语言支持:覆盖中英文及编程语言(如SQL、Java代码)的混合查询。
2.2 数据分析的自动化革命
- 自动ETL:通过自然语言指令完成数据清洗与转换,例如”将CSV中的日期列转为时间戳并过滤异常值”。
- 可视化生成:根据分析目标自动推荐图表类型(如趋势图、热力图),支持D3.js、Plotly等前端库的代码输出。
- 异常检测:基于时序分析模型识别数据波动,自动生成告警规则。
2.3 自然语言处理的工业级应用
- 文档智能:提取技术文档中的API参数、返回值说明,生成结构化JSON。
{
"function": "deepseek.search",
"parameters": {
"query": {"type": "string", "required": true},
"filters": {"type": "array", "items": {"type": "string"}}
},
"returns": {"type": "array", "description": "匹配结果列表"}
}
- 代码生成:支持从自然语言描述生成可执行代码,例如”用TensorFlow实现一个图像分类模型,使用ResNet50架构”。
- 多轮对话管理:在客服场景中保持对话状态,自动调用知识库与工单系统。
三、DeepSeek的典型应用场景
3.1 企业知识管理
某科技公司通过DeepSeek构建内部知识图谱,将分散在Confluence、GitHub、邮件中的技术文档统一索引,工程师搜索效率提升60%,重复造轮子问题减少40%。
3.2 智能客服系统
电商平台接入DeepSeek后,客服机器人可同时处理文本、语音、图片查询,例如用户上传商品瑕疵照片后,系统自动识别问题类型并推荐补偿方案,客户满意度提升25%。
3.3 研发效能提升
开发团队使用DeepSeek的代码生成功能,将需求文档到可运行代码的转化时间从3天缩短至4小时,同时通过静态分析提前发现30%的潜在缺陷。
四、技术选型与开发实践建议
4.1 部署方案选择
- 云服务优先:对于初创团队,推荐使用DeepSeek SaaS版本,按查询量计费,无需维护基础设施。
- 私有化部署:金融、医疗等合规要求高的行业,可选择容器化部署方案,支持Kubernetes集群管理。
4.2 开发集成指南
- API调用示例:
```python
import requests
def deepseek_search(query, filters=None):
headers = {“Authorization”: “Bearer YOUR_API_KEY”}
payload = {
“query”: query,
“filters”: filters or [],
“max_results”: 10
}
response = requests.post(
“https://api.deepseek.com/v1/search“,
json=payload,
headers=headers
)
return response.json()
```
- 性能优化:对于高频调用场景,建议启用缓存机制,将静态查询结果存储在Redis中。
4.3 风险控制要点
- 数据隐私:敏感信息需经过脱敏处理后再传入系统。
- 模型偏见:定期使用公平性检测工具(如AI Fairness 360)评估结果。
- 应急方案:设置 fallback 机制,当DeepSeek服务不可用时自动切换至传统搜索引擎。
五、未来展望:AI搜索的无限可能
随着多模态大模型(如GPT-4V、Gemini)的演进,DeepSeek正探索以下方向:
- 实时搜索:结合5G与物联网数据,实现设备状态的即时查询。
- 因果推理:超越相关性分析,回答”为什么”类问题。
- 自主代理:构建能自动完成复杂任务的AI助手,如”调研竞争对手产品并生成对比报告”。
对于开发者与企业用户而言,DeepSeek不仅是一个工具,更是重构信息处理流程的契机。通过合理利用其能力,可显著提升研发效率、优化决策质量,在数字化竞争中占据先机。建议从具体业务场景切入,采用”最小可行产品(MVP)”策略快速验证价值,再逐步扩展应用范围。
发表评论
登录后可评论,请前往 登录 或 注册